How they compare
Portugal currently reports 8.08 million m3 against 6.85 million m3 in Finland, a difference of 1.23 million m3.
That makes Portugal's figure about 1.2 times Finland's.
The two have swapped places 9 times across 27 shared years of data; in 1998 it was Finland ahead.
Finland ranks 13th and Portugal ranks 10th of 90 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Finland averaged higher in 1 and Portugal in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Finland | Portugal |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 4.63 million m3 | 3.67 million m3 | 963,135 m3 | Finland |
| 2000s | 5.24 million m3 | 5.79 million m3 | 547,819 m3 | Portugal |
| 2010s | 7.32 million m3 | 7.39 million m3 | 68,287 m3 | Portugal |
| 2020s | 7.47 million m3 | 8.20 million m3 | 728,948 m3 | Portugal |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
